HOW MANY SINGLE ADULTS ARE IN YOUR CHURCH? (all ages/types) WANT TO FIND OUT? TRY THIS SURVEY! It will take only 3 minutes It will enlighten your church staff It will educate your church congregation It will show the need for Single Adult/Young Adult Ministry It will give credibility to your ministry It will build support for Single Adult/Young Adult Ministry

TAKE A SUNDAY AM SURVEY! Show these slides of demographics-Then… Ask these 3 questions in a Sunday service Have ALL ages of single adults stand simultaneously Emphasize ALL the types of single adults-(some don’t admit to singleness easily or consider themselves single) Thank them for standing after each question Have each group remain standing till ALL 3 questions have been asked After EACH slide with a question, say, “Do you see how singleness affects the church?”

44% of Adults are Single Never Married 48 M 26% Divorced20.5 M 10% Widowed13.5 M 6.8% Separated 7.2 M 3.6% (marital/military/other) Single Adult Ministry Journal-Issue 130, page 7
